Summary

According to the bill, the payment of unemployment benefits will be stopped. In the future, in case of job loss, the registered unemployed person will be paid either income-based unemployment insurance benefit or the new basic rate unemployment insurance benefit created by the bill. The current unemployment insurance benefit will be renamed income-based unemployment insurance benefit and the conditions for receiving it will not be changed. Unemployment insurance benefit at the basic rate is assigned to a person who is unemployed before being registered worked for at least 8 months during the previous 36 months. Compensation is paid for up to 180 days, and the amount of compensation is the same for everyone, 50% of the minimum salary of the previous calendar year (in 2024, the amount of compensation would be 374.50 euros per month). People who do not meet these requirements can apply for subsistence allowance from the local government. According to the forecast, the costs of the implementation of the law will increase by 2.3 million euros in 2026, because at the same time payments will be made before the unemployment benefits and unemployment insurance benefit at the base rate determined according to the new system. In the years 2027 and 2028, there will be cost savings of approx. 23.2 and approx. 25.3 million euros, respectively. The changes will take effect on January 1, 2026. In addition, the problem raised by the Chancellor of Justice, that the current procedure allows a student up to the age of 24 living separately from his family, to pay subsistence allowance only if his family was awarded subsistence allowance in the previous or current bullet. It is also provided for the possibility to pay subsistence allowance as an exception to students up to the age of 24 who live separately from their families, if their relationships with family members have been broken or the parents lack the ability to support their children. During the procedure, the Social Committee made an amendment proposal to bring the Work Ability Support Act into line with the Constitution. On June 6, 2024, the plenary session discussed the proposal of the Chancellor of Justice, the plenary session supported it proposal of the chancellor of justice, and the social committee was tasked with initiating a draft to bring the work ability support act into line with the constitution. The amendment adds to the exceptions for calculating the amount of work capacity allowance the possibility to also include the situation where a person is paid in one calendar month both the salary of the previous month and the salary earned in the same month at the end of the employment contract or service relationship, which would normally be (i.e. if the employment contract or the employment relationship would not have been terminated) paid out the following month. A person can apply for the recalculation of the work capacity allowance if he proves to the unemployment fund that his income exceeds 90 times the daily rate because he has been paid in one calendar month both the salary of the previous month and the salary earned in the same month due to the termination of the employment contract, but not yet paid. In order to recalculate the work capacity allowance, an application and employer's certificate must be submitted to the unemployment fund, where you can see the received fees and the type of fees, and an extract from the employment contract, where you can see the agreed time of receiving the salary.
